## Ownership

The DripMinder scheduling core is maintained under the Fernhollow internal stewardship model. All changes to the valve-timing logic, the moisture sensor polling loop, and the failover queue require sign-off from the designated owner before merge. Security-relevant patches bypass the normal review queue but still require owner acknowledgment within 24 hours. For escalation purposes, the accountable individual is listed directly below.

approver of bagug-bagag = Holael Pramir

Quick note on the Harroway Annex loading dock: deliveries are accepted 08:00–12:00 only, Monday to Friday. Anything arriving later gets turned away, so please brief your couriers. Oversized pallets need a heads-up to facilities the day before. If you need to pop down and meet a driver yourself, the dock door keypad takes the code below.

door code, yagap-bahof: bdg-O-05

TICKET-4182: Donation-receipt mailer in GivingLoop sends duplicate receipts when a donor edits their pledge within five minutes of payment. Root cause is a missing idempotency check in the receipt queue worker. Fix merged by Priya on the mailer team; deploy targeted for Thursday. The affected build token is listed below.

build token for kagaf-hahof: htk14_9d3d4d26d7d8de